    We posted a highlight from our session with Active Childyesterday and there are already three comments: Incredible. Amazing. Haunting.

    These single word proclamations seem to reflect the general response to Active Child’s music, which was a huge hit at the Music Box last night where they played to a sold out crowd opening for M83.

    Singer Pat Grossi has a familiar story about how he found his way to music – performing as part of a Boy’s Choir in Philadelphia. But it’s his incredible range and swirling falsetto that really sets him apart. That and the fact that he plays the harp!

    The music draws you in instantly and the spectacle of his voice, combined with harp strumming and a shock of red hair, is really a sight to see. Check it all out here.
